Quote by Romain Rolland

“Any man who is really a man must learn to be alone in the midst of others, to think alone for others, and, if necessary, against others.”

Romain Rolland, a French dramatist, novelist, essayist, and music critic, was born on January 29, 1866, and died on December 30, 1944. Known for his profound insights into human nature and rich emotional expression, his works include 'Jean-Christophe'. more
